Charlie Hotel in transit from El Paso to Odessa, the mountain in the picture is Guadalupe Peak with El Capitan to the right. Guadalupe Peak is the highest point in Texas with an elevation of 8,751 feet (2,667 m). It is located in Guadalupe Mountains National Park, part of the Guadalupe Mountains range in southeastern New Mexico and West Texas. The mountain is about 90 miles (140 km) east of El Paso and about 50 miles (80 km) southwest of Carlsbad, New Mexico. It rises more than 3,000 feet (910 m) above the arid floor of the Chihuahuan Desert.
